- Cardinal TetraParacheirodon axelrodi
The cardinal tetra, Paracheirodon axelrodi, is a freshwaterfish of the characin family (familyCharacidae) of order Characiformes. It is nativeto the upper Orinoco and Negro Rivers in South America.
- Black TetraHyphessobrycon herbertaxelrodi
The black neon tetra (Hyphessobrycon herbertaxelrodi)is a freshwater fish of the characinfamily (family Characidae) oforder Characiformes. It is native to theParaguay basin of southern Brazil.

- Blood Fins TetraAphyocharax anisitsi
The Bloodfin Tetra is a type of tropical fish. Bloodfins are comparatively large tetras, growing to 5.5 cm. Its notable feature (as the name suggest) is the blood red colouration at the tail, dorsal, anal and adipose fin.
- Black Phantom TetraHyphessobrycon megalopterus
The black phantom tetra (Hyphessobrycon megalopterus)is a freshwater fish of the characinfamily (family Characidae) oforder Characiformes. It is native to theParaguay, Guaporé, andMamore basins in Brazil and Bolivia.

- Neon Pygmy GobyEviota pellucida
Eviota pellucida is a Goby from the Eastern Indian Ocean. It occasionally makes its way into the aquarium trade. It grows to a size of 3cm in length.
